Escapade Tiny House

What a spectacular tiny house from France! Inside it’s 185 square feet you’ll find a kitchen with plenty of cabinet space, a bathroom with composting toilet, living room, dining space, and a sleeping loft accessed by stairs. Inside the walls you’ll find spruce framing and wool insulation. To learn more visit the Baluchon Petite Maison …

Art of Living in a Dordogne’s Tiny Mud Home

In a small forest in France’s Dordogne, self-taught carpenter Menthé built his home with a living roof and mud walls… The result is a charming and very cozy home that fits perfectly into the woodland.” – Kirsten Dirksen via Art of living in a Dordogne’s tiny mud home with living roof – YouTube.

Castel Meur

“Castel Meur is the name of this amazing house. She turns her back to the sea since 1861, the year of its construction, to protect it from violent winds during storms, that frequent this place. This tiny house was built at a time when building permits did not exist, where everyone could build her own …

Command Post

While this little command post at a Marina in France is not a house, it reminded me of fire tower-like tiny houses. Not exactly a warm and rustic timber frame fire tower but for those who like concrete and steel, a really nicely done little building. Command Post

Dans mon arbre

Dans mon arbre is a treehouse company in Grenoble, France. Each treehouse they build is one of a kind and designed for each individual tree and client. I was really impressed with all the different designs they’ve come up with so far and the high level of craftmanship. The treehouse pictured here is especially cool …
